How it began . . .

James "Bo" Green

In 2013, one of our basketball team members (James “Bo” Green) was diagnosed with brain cancer. This behooved us to move quickly on his behalf, to attempt to help him with unforeseen expenses. His love for basketball, gave us the idea to use it to achieve our goal by way of a basketball tournament. The first tournament, called "Ballin 4 Bo" 

was a great success. Unfortunately, a couple months 

after the event, he lost his battle with cancer.


 Bo Green was such a great impact in the lives of others, especially the youth in the community. The love he displayed for helping children was overwhelming and unmatched. Mindful of this adoration, we decided to continue the same power of love by having an annual basketball tournament to raise money for a child 

battling cancer. Although our mission to help offset medical costs of children battling cancer has not changed, 

in 2021, the event name changed to the 

"Cincinnati Contest of Champions"
